Can gifted by coworker dated 030111. Poured to pint.
A: Pours a quite dark brown with a pinky of fine-bubbled head. A tip of the glass reveals constant carbonation streaming up from the depths. No lacing to speak of.
S: Big semi-sweet toasted coconut and chocolate. Good balance.
T: Nice coconut here, too. Roasted malts with a hint of coffee. Mild, pleasant sweetness that plays nicely with the bitterness.
M: Medium-light. Too carbonated, though. A little sticky afterward.
A nice beer; pleasantly surprised considering the can date. I think one in a sitting is plenty. This filled in for dessert, and did so admirably.
I'd have one again.

The name itself warrants curiosity, and being a fan of coconut and the occaisional porter, I figured why not?Poured ino a snifter, it borders on brown/black, completely opaque, and pours a half finger of a tan supple head,lacing is average for a porter.
Aroma is toasty, roasty and coffee-like, with deep roasted malts and the toasted coconut sweetness playing a subtle part in the nose, and this becomes more apparent upon warming.
Taste is smooth and very rich with a pleasant roasted quality, and just a hint of the toasted coconut flavor for a semi sweet finish to round things out nicely.
Mouthfeel is medium to heavy, rich and creamy texture,superb carbonation to move the flavors along.
As long as you aren't expecting to drink a Mounds Bar, and enjoy porters, Maui Brewing Coconut porter is a well crafted and delicious concoction that has the ability to satisfy on a number of levels, and is a really nice way to end the day.

Source/Serving: 12oz can
S: Burnt bread crust, wet moss, toasted almonds, grill residue. Hints of toasted coconut, spruce, decaying leaves.
T: Slightly sweet, faintly tart up front that hits with a smooth rich toasty, caramel roastiness. In the perfect roast range between toffee and coffee/chocolate, which gives the roastiness some depth and richness. Creamy, oily and smooth. Coconut hits in the middle, clean and toasty, along with light coffee and a nice nuttiness. Little to no harshness from the roastiness or bitterness, but its well balanced and only slightly sweet. Acidity is faint. Faintly mossy hops. Moderately high body. Finish really shows off the coconut and nuttiness, with a lingering toasted bread and smooth chocolate note.
Notes: A well-organized brew
